Today, Munich Regional Court ruled in favour of GEMA, finding Suno has infringed copyrighted musical works with its AI tool for generating music. It is the second copyright case brought by GEMA over AI-generated musical output.

Today, the Regional Court Munich handed down its decision in the dispute between GEMA and Suno AI. US company Suno AI is the provider of an AI tool that generates complete, playable songs using simple text commands or prompts. The collecting society accuses Suno of systematically using its members’ repertoire to train the system without acquiring licences or paying royalties. In this specific case, GEMA is asserting claims on behalf of the composers of six well-known musical works.
The collecting society GEMA brought an action at the Munich court for cease and desist, disclosure and damages against Suno in January 2025 (case ID: 42 O 763/25). Rather than patents, this case concerns the copyright of music creators.
The 42nd Civil Chamber, which specialises in copyright law, heard the case in March. Originally a judgment was scheduled for 12 June but was postponed to 31 July. The chamber under presiding judge Elke Schwager has now ruled in favour of GEMA. The court has ordered Suno to cease the unauthorised reproduction of the protected musical works and to stop using the works to train the AI model. The court also ordered Suno to disclose information regarding revenue generated in connection with the infringements and to pay damages. The amount has not yet been determined. The judgment is not yet enforceable.
It was undisputed that the model developed by Suno was trained using the six musical works at issue. According to Munich Regional Court, Suno used so-called ‘stream-ripping’ techniques to extract well-known musical works from the YouTube platform. In doing so, it circumvented the so-called ‘rolling cipher’, a technical protection measure designed to prevent downloading.
During the oral hearing, GEMA stated that it was able to document that the Suno system produces audio content which, in terms of melody, harmony and rhythm, partially corresponds to six world-famous works, namely ‘Daddy Cool’ by Frank Farian; ‘Rasputin’ by Frank Farian, Fred Jay and George Reyam; ‘Forever Young’ and ‘Big in Japan’ by Marian Gold, Bernhard Lloyd and Frank Mertens; ‘Atemlos’ by Kristina Bach; and ‘Mambo No. 5’ by David Lubega and Christian Pletschacher.
GEMA regards this as unauthorised reproduction under copyright law and therefore demanded an appropriate share of the AI provider’s subscription revenue for its members. Copyright infringements are alleged in both the US and Germany. The song lyrics were not at issue.
Suno contested this. It argued that the musical pieces are not protected by copyright in the first place. Furthermore, it claimed that training with the musical works is covered by the ‘fair use’ doctrine under the applicable US law, and that the training data is neither contained in the model nor stored within it. Instead, claimed Suno, the weights and parameters of the model represent mathematically learnt patterns and generalised features derived from the training data, such as syntactic, semantic and contextual relationships.
Insofar as German law applies, Suno claimed there is no use relevant to copyright and any potential infringements are justified by the exceptions for text and data mining.
The court did not agree with Suno’s arguments. According to the ruling, GEMA is entitled to the claims asserted both on the basis of the reproduction of the musical works that took place as part of the training carried out in the US, and on the basis of the reproduction in the model and the communication to the public in the outputs in Germany.
The court considers itself competent to rule on the case, including alleged copyright infringements that took place in the US. A special rule in Germany’s Collecting Societies Act (VGG) gives organisations such as GEMA a privileged court venue for cases connected with their role in managing copyright.
The court found that the disputed songs were effectively stored within the defendant’s AI music models, which were hosted on servers in Germany. This can happen through a process called ‘memorisation’: rather than merely learning general patterns from training data, an AI model can retain parts of the original works and later reproduce them. The court concluded that the similarities between the original songs and the AI-generated outputs were too extensive and specific to be coincidental.
According to the court, this amounts to an unauthorised copying of the songs under German copyright law. The legal exception for text and data mining does not apply, because the works were not only analysed during training but retained in the models in a reproducible form.
The court also held that Suno was responsible when the AI generated outputs in Germany that reproduced recognisable original elements of the songs. It was not the users who bore responsibility, because the users only entered basic prompts, such as lyrics and a musical style. The defendant designed, trained and operated the models, and therefore controlled the system that produced the allegedly infringing outputs.
In addition, simply making the AI model and music-generation application available to the public was considered by the court to infringe the right of public performance under German copyright law.
For copying that occurred during training in the US, the court stated that US copyright law applies. The court found that the copies and outputs were not protected by the US fair use doctrine. It distinguished this case from the Bartz and Kadrey decisions in the US, where courts found AI training to be fair use largely because the original training materials were not reproduced for users in the outputs. By contrast, in the GEMA against Suno case simple prompts led to outputs that were substantially similar to the original musical works.
Suno now intends to explore all options, including an appeal.
The lawsuit against Suno is the second AI-related lawsuit brought by GEMA. The collecting society also sued the US provider OpenAI regarding the AI-generated reproduction of well-known song lyrics. In that case, too, the Munich Regional Court examined the use of the copyright-protected works and ruled in favour of GEMAÂ in November.
GEMA represents around 103,000 members from all over the world, including composers, lyricists and music publishers. According to its own statements, it is seeking partnership-based solutions with AI companies.
Suno AI entered into such a partnership with Warner Music at the end of 2025 to licence its music catalogue for new Suno AI models. Warner had previously also taken legal action against Suno, as had Universal Music and Sony Music Entertainment.
GEMA retained a multi-office team from Berlin IP law firm Raue. The firm has a high profile in Germany for its media and publishing law expertise. Partner and co-head of the media practice Robert Heine led the case. He regularly assists collecting societies such as Corint Media, Gesellschaft zur Verwertung von Leistungsschutzrechten (GVL) and VG Musikedition.
Within the firm, Heine also leads on matters relating to the use of artificial intelligence in legal work. Media and copyright lawyers Felix Stang, Anna Bernzen, and Johannes von Rosen provided support. GEMA’s head of legal, Kai Welp, prepared the claim in tandem with Raue.
Suno relied on Latham & Watkins. Munich-based dispute resolution partner Anne Löhner led the case, with support from IP partner Susan Kempe-Müller and commercial litigator and partner Christoph Baus. (Co-authors: Norbert Plützer, Sonja Behrens)
